Stop At: The Three Servicemen Statue
5 Henry Bacon Drive Northwest, Washington, DC 20004
The Three Servicemen Statue in D.C. honors Vietnam War veterans with a bronze depiction of three soldiers—White, Black, and Hispanic—standing in solidarity. Sculpted by Frederick Hart, it captures their camaraderie, sacrifice, and resilience, offering a human connection to the nearby Vietnam Veterans Memorial.
